Elden Ring Builds: 18 Ideas for High-Focus Mages
Elden Ring’s magic system opens up a vast world of possibilities for players who want to wield powerful sorceries and incantations. If you’re looking to maximize your Intelligence or Faith stats and create a high-focus mage build, there are plenty of paths to explore. Whether you prefer raw spell damage, utility, or hybrid styles, the following 18 build ideas will help you find the perfect setup to dominate both PvE and PvP.
1. Pure Sorcery Glass Cannon
Max out Intelligence and focus on high-damage sorceries like Comet Azur. Use light armor to maintain mobility, and equip staffs with the best sorcery scaling.
2. Faith-Based Healer and Buffer
Pump Faith to unlock powerful healing and buffing incantations. Pair this with talismans that boost healing potency and defensive spells to survive longer in battle.
3. Hybrid Spellblade
Combine melee weapons with sorcery or incantations. Use spells to buff your weapon or debuff enemies while engaging in close combat.
4. Crystal Sorcerer
Focus on crystal sorceries and use staffs like the Crystal Staff for superior scaling. This build excels at long-range damage but requires precision and timing.
5. Pyromancer
Mix Faith and Intelligence for access to both fire-based incantations and sorceries. This build brings high burst damage with a focus on area denial.
6. Focused Arcane Mage
Utilize high Arcane along with Intelligence to cast unique spells that rely on status effects and magic scaling.
7. Summoner Mage
Focus on incantations that summon spirits and allies to fight alongside you, supporting your magic with additional firepower.
8. Pure Faithcaster
Specialize in Faith to access devastating holy spells. Often combined with healing abilities and buffs for team-oriented play.
9. Dark Sorcery Specialist
Use Dark sorceries that require a balanced Intelligence and Faith investment for high-risk, high-reward damage.

11. Defensive Spellcaster
Invest in spells that provide shields and healing, alongside defensive armor to survive tougher encounters.
12. Speed Caster
Prioritize gear and Elden Ring Items that reduce casting time and increase FP regeneration, allowing for rapid spellcasting.
13. Status Effect Mage
Build around spells that inflict poison, scarlet rot, or frostbite, overwhelming enemies with continuous damage.
14. Dual Caster
Carry two different staffs or sacred seals, swapping between offensive and utility spells depending on the situation.
15. Heavy Armor Mage
Combine high Focus stats with heavy armor for survivability without sacrificing too much spellcasting potential.
16. Elemental Specialist
Choose a single elemental school (fire, lightning, or frost) and maximize spells and buffs related to that element.
17. Long-Range Sniper
Focus on spells with great range and high damage output, complemented by stealth or positioning tactics.
